The 2019 Peplo Rosé, in bottle about 10 weeks when tasted, is a roughly equal blend of Agiorgitiko, Syrah and Mavrofilero, with only the Agiorgitiko in acacia barrels for four months. The Mavrofilero was in egg-shaped amphorae with skin contact. Nicely dry, it comes in at 12.5% alcohol. Overall, this is not even a little bit like the producer's other, more exuberant pink this issue. The modest wood treatment cuts the flavor slightly and makes this a bit sterner, just a little. It does not subsume the flavor or vigor of this wine, though. Elegant, refined and very sophisticated, with muted cherry nuances, this has a silky texture and lifted fruit. Although it has adequate body, it feels very graceful, dancing lightly across the tongue. The Zoe is best used on its own. This is perhaps better for the table as a food pairing, although it is certainly balanced well enough to drink on its own too. This is very nice and a step up. Drink date: 2020-2023.
